2.
Name
three major VFA’s produced in the rumen and used as energy sources by the cow.
Answer:
1.
Acetic
acid
2.
Propionic
acid
3.
Butyric
acid
3. If heifers are
adequately grown, what are four advantages to calving them at 24 months of age
or earlier?
Answer:
1. More lifetime
productivity
2. Lower rearing costs
3. Reduction in replacement
herd size
4. Greater voluntary culling
5. Increased herd days in
milk
6. More profitability
4. During the spring and summer of 2004, dairy
farmers’ milk checks have reached historical high prices/cwt. Name three factors that economists attribute
to the price increase.
Answer:
1.
Smaller cattle inventories caused by low milk prices in 2002 & 2003
(farmers went out of business or restricted expansion)
2.
Canadian border closed to cattle imports because of BSE restrictions
3.
Reduction in BST inventories
5. Higher
feed costs
6. Higher
gasoline costs
5. Name four symptoms of Foot-And-Mouth Disease
(FMD):
Answer:
1. Blisters, followed by
lesions in the mouth or on the feet
2.
Excessive salivating
3.
Lameness
4.
Temperature rise
5.
Reduced feed intake because of lesions
6.
Radical decrease in milk production

14.
Forages,
which are ensiled with too much moisture, result in the formation of an
undesirable organic acid. What is the
4-carbon acid?
Answer: Butyric acid
15. What is the name of the enzyme, that is the
commercial form of rennin most commonly used to coagulate milk in the
manufacture of cheese in the U.S.?
Answer: Chymosin

Name four ways to avoid chemical accidents on the farm.
Answer:
1.
Acknowledge
the danger
2.
Keep
children away
3.
Store
chemicals properly
4.
Closed-handling
dispensers
5.
Acquire
material safety data sheets
6.
Supplement
written warning labels (verbal instruction)
7.
Wear
protective clothing and eyewear
8.
Don’t
mix chemicals together
9.
Follow
label directions
10.
Train
workers in safety procedures
23.
Name three reasons a dairy cow might have poor quality colostrum.
Answer:
1.Cow dry less than 3-4
weeks
2.Premilking
3.Leaking teats
4.Dirty udder & teats
5.Cow producing large
quantity in first milking
6.2 year old vs. older cow
